High-Protein Chicken Cottage Cheese Enchilada Bowls

High-Protein Chicken Cottage Cheese Enchilada Bowls Made Easy

A nourishing and satisfying dish, these High-Protein Chicken Cottage Cheese Enchilada Bowls are easy to prepare and packed with zesty flavors.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 30 minutes
Total Time 40 minutes
Servings: 4 bowls
Course: Dinner
Cuisine: Mexican
Calories: 450

Ingredients
  

For the Filling
  • 1 cup Low-Fat Cottage Cheese Blend for a smoother texture
  • 1 cup Enchilada Sauce Store-bought or homemade
  • 2 cups Rotisserie Chicken Breast Shredded
  • 1 packet Taco Seasoning Adjust based on heat preference
  • 1 medium Red Bell Pepper Diced; can be added fresh or sautéed
  • 1 cup Canned Corn Drained
  • 1 can Black Beans Rinsed thoroughly
  • 1 cup Shredded Cheese (Mexican Blend or Cheddar) Consider low-fat or dairy-free options
For the Garnish
  • 1 cup Chopped Cilantro
  • 1 medium Avocado Slices
  • 1 cup Greek Yogurt or Sour Cream Optional

Equipment

  • Food Processor
  • Mixing Bowl
  • Microwave-Safe Bowls

Method
 

Step-by-Step Instructions
  1. In a food processor, combine low-fat cottage cheese and enchilada sauce. Blend until smooth, about 30 seconds.
  2. Transfer the mixture to a large mixing bowl. Add shredded rotisserie chicken and taco seasoning, mixing well.
  3. Gently fold in the diced red bell pepper, drained canned corn, and rinsed black beans.
  4. Portion the mixture into microwave-safe bowls. Sprinkle shredded cheese on top and heat in the microwave for 1-2 minutes.
  5. Remove from the microwave and top each bowl with freshly chopped cilantro, avocado slices, and Greek yogurt or sour cream.
